Instagram Threads vs Twitter
1. Since each of those are microblogging web sites, the character restrict is a key factor to know that impacts your expertise. That’s how a lot you may write in a publish on these platforms. Threads enable for 500 character depend whereas Twitter allows you to write solely till you hit 280 characters.

2. One other type of content material which you can publish is movies. Threads help as much as 5-minute lengthy movies whereas Twitter allows you to publish solely 2-minute 20-second movies.

3. You need to faucet enter thrice to begin a line of threads on Instagram Threads. In the meantime, you simply must faucet on the Plus icon to begin a thread on Twitter.
4. I noticed Threads doesn’t help hashtags solely once I cross-posted a tweet from Twitter. You possibly can’t seek for content material based mostly on hashtags and that’s a significant characteristic that’s accessible in most different social media platforms.
5. Threads doesn’t characteristic the choice to seek for posts/content material on the platform. So, a significant cutback on discoverability. We hope this could make its approach to Threads quickly, particularly as a result of Instagram and Fb have it.
6. Threads doesn’t have an possibility but to avoid wasting a draft of the publish to take care of it later. Whereas on Twitter, while you hit the cancel button, you get an possibility to avoid wasting the draft.
7. The privateness and notification settings are totally different on Twitter and Threads. The latter appears to have imported these settings from Instagram.

8. There are not any adverts on Threads for now. Mark Zuckerberg has mentioned Threads will get adverts solely when it hits a 1 billion consumer base. Twitter, however, has an advert equipment within the works. However, since Meta is a lot better at this sport, it gained’t be lengthy earlier than you see adverts on Threads too.
9. Threads will quickly work with Fediverse and make use of the ActivityPub protocol. It’ll then be a decentralized social networking platform like Mastodon (additionally AcitivtyPub-based) and Blue Sky. Twitter is a part of the OG social media membership that’s centralized.

10. There are not any trending matters web page, no user-generated alt texts, and different parts of Twitter. What it has nonetheless is an enormous group from the get-go as customers enroll with their Instagram account and may rapidly deliver Instagram followers with a single click on. Not simply that, in case you are an Instagram subscriber, you receives a commission verification on Threads.
